Output 58a221371c4b9a679b9d26a7f8536aa48cdb378dc1476aae41ad5e20f2e10f76:0

value
49818800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85376b06aebe6f379f5681fea6661b5c6b1c7c74 OP_EQUAL
address
ML3YVTZHrRLtwY7hFngKvteVURzmE9qjeL
transaction
58a221371c4b9a679b9d26a7f8536aa48cdb378dc1476aae41ad5e20f2e10f76
spent
true